Enel Acquires Demand Energy Networks, Inc.
January 11, 2017
Italian utility Enel (through its North America renewables unit) acquired 100% of U.S.-based Demand Energy Networks, Inc., a developer and operator of energy storage systems and the DEN.OS energy management software, for an undisclosed amount. Enel said the deal will strengthen its position in the battery storage market and allow rapid global scaling of Demand Energy's software and project capabilities across Enel's renewables portfolio.
